4605. Sidón

Sidón: Sidon, a maritime city of Phoenicia
Original Word: Σιδών, ῶνος, ἡ
Part of Speech: Noun, Feminine
Transliteration: Sidón
Phonetic Spelling: (sid-one')
Short Definition: Sidon
Definition: Sidon, a great coast city of Phoenicia.

Word Origin
of Hebrew origin Tsidon
Definition
Sidon, a maritime city of Phoenicia
NASB Word Usage
Sidon (9).
